"By 180 votes to 136, the Senate adopted the bill aimed at regulating medical practices in the care of minors suffering from gender dysphoria. The text submitted by the LR group received the support of some centrist elected officials and the two RN senators.

Jacqueline Eustache-Brinio, the LR senator who initiated the bill, immediately clarified her intentions. "This text is neither a transphobic text, nor a desire to psychiatristize transidentity, nor an attack on children's rights," she assured before castigating "the attacks by activist associations that operate like many activist associations: through threats and intimidation."

Her text was widely criticized on the left-wing benches, which had organized a round table on the "state of transphobia in France" with association leaders the day before. In a public session, the environmentalist group tried, without success, to have a motion of prior rejection of the text voted on. "The real problems you have are that trans people exist and that you can do nothing to prevent it and that no law will be able to do so," scolded the environmentalist senator, Mélanie Vogel in a very personal speech citing the case of her niece, "a little trans girl that I love infinitely [...] I am not anxious about her transidentity at all [...] What worries me is the fact of knowing that I cannot totally protect (her) from people like you," she added.

The text, composed of 4 articles, strictly regulates the prescription of puberty blockers to minors in specialized reference centers listed by decree and in compliance with a minimum period of two years after the first consultation and the "verification by the medical team of the absence of contraindications as well as the patient's capacity for discernment". This is one of the notable additions of the rapporteur Alain Milon (LR). Originally, the text purely and simply prohibited the prescription of these puberty blockers to minors. After passing through the committee, only hormonal treatments and gender reassignment surgery are prohibited for minors. But for opponents of the text, the two-year period also amounts to indirectly prohibiting these puberty blockers. During the debates, the rapporteur of the text, Alain Milon, justified the implementation of this period. "We heard the (medical) teams. They all told us the same thing: It takes us an average of two years to be certain of the diagnosis."

Transidentity of minors: the Senate adopts the LR bill in a stormy atmosphere
